Ok i have been playin the old version of FF4 (ff2) for snes on my emulator and i notices i have an item called the rat tail.  Is this the same as the Pink Tail or does it have some specific use.  I remember seing it posted somewhere but i'm not sure and can't seem to find it here.  Does anyone know its use?

The Rat Tail, if I remember correctly, is the item you get in the land of Summoned monsters beyond the warp point in the first level.  This is the vital key to getting the vital Adamant required to make Excalibur!  Here's how you get it.

Take your newfound Rat Tail and go back to the overworld.  Make sure you're on your yellow airship, not the one with the drill on it.  Use your yellow airship to pick up the hovercraft and head northeast of Mysidia.  Land in the town of Silvera and board your hovercraft.  Ride the shallows to the little cave that is southeast of Silvera's coast.  Inside, a man there will give you some Adamant for your Rat Tail.  Take that adamant and head back to the underground.  Head south past the dwarven castle to the Smith's shop.  Go in the house, go up the stairs, and give the Adamant to the Smith.  (You can also get an elixir in the bookshelf in his bedroom).  The Smith will take your Legend sword that you received in Mt. Ordeals and forge Excalibur.  I'm not quite sure on how long you must wait to get the sword, but I don't recall it being too long.  After the period of time, he'll give you the Excalibur.  Later on in the game you can return to the Smith's shop and see that one of the dwarves is now selling throwing darts for Edge.  Hope that helps!
